Maxi Salas
Maxi Salas is a professional footballer known for his role as a forward for Racing Club in Argentina. Recently, he gained attention for his contribution in a classic match against Independiente, where he assisted Gastón Martirena in scoring the opening goal. Salas has been recognized for his vision and ability to create scoring opportunities, showcasing his talent in crucial moments of the game.
